Consider The Path That Runoff Will Take Across Your Property

Whenever you are planning to have your parking lot paved, one of the most important considerations will be determining the path that runoff will take across the property. Without this consideration, your parking lot could be more likely to experience erosion or to have large puddles form that could make it harder for individuals to walk across your parking lot once they have parked. You can limit the problems that uncontrolled runoff can create by having the center of the parking lot at an elevated level and installing gutters or other runoff control measures.

Have A Layout That Optimizes The Flow Of Traffic Through The Parking Lot

The flow of traffic through your parking lot will be another major consideration that will have to be addressed. Otherwise, you could have a parking lot that is difficult for your customers to navigate or that increases the chances of there being an accident on your property. As you are creating the layout for the parking lot, you will want to have a firm idea as to the path that the cars will take through the property. If you are worried about individuals failing to follow this plan, you can help to encourage individuals to follow the correct flow through the parking lot by angling the spots. When the spots are angled correctly, individuals will find it far more difficult to get into a spot when they are not approaching the spots from the right direction.

Opt For Reflective Paint For The Parking Lot Striping

Making sure that the striping for the parking lot is easy to see while being necessary if you are to make it possible for your customers to navigate the parking lot during periods of poor visibility. Using reflective paint for these markings can help to provide this as the paint will be extremely easy to see during periods of rain, fog, or other times when the visibility conditions may not be ideal. This type of paint can be extremely durable, which can allow it to last for years before needing to eventually be reapplied.
